Dr. Bippin Makoond (SVP Global Head of Data & AI | Global Head of Innovation, Inetum - Inetum Suisse SA)

Dr. Bippin Makoond is the SVP Global Head of Data & AI and Global Head of Innovation at Inetum, where he leads the development of AI-driven solutions and innovation strategies that help organizations unlock business value from emerging technologies.

Holding a PhD in Computer Science, Bippin brings together expertise in artificial intelligence, neuroscience, and game design to create human-centred approaches to innovation. Formerly CTO for the Strategic Deal Team at Infosys, he led technology innovation and the design of transformative AI solutions for global enterprises.

An Industrial Advisor to the University of Oxford, Bippin is passionate about bridging academia and industry, helping organizations harness the power of AI while fostering creativity, continuous learning, and future-ready skills. He is a recognized thought leader on the intersection of AI, innovation, creativity, and human potential.


AI Economics: Closing the Gap Between Investment and Impact

Short Narrative

Organizations are investing heavily in AI, yet many struggle to demonstrate meaningful business value. As AI adoption accelerates, five interconnected challenges—Security, Data, Process, People, and Governance—are preventing many organizations from realizing the returns they expected. This session explores how leaders can move beyond AI experimentation and focus on what really matters: measurable business outcomes. 

5 Key Takeaways

  • Why AI adoption does not automatically translate into business value.
  • The five crises that are limiting AI ROI across organizations.
  • How leading enterprises are moving from pilots to scalable business impact.
  • Why governance, trust, and data foundations matter more than the latest AI model.
  • A practical framework for measuring AI success through productivity, growth, resilience, and risk reduction. 

In Summary

The winners of the AI era will not be those who deploy the most AI, but those who create the most value from it.
